RE GOSHAWK II. REAR AXLE. X4256

We send herewith N.sch. 1283 showing two proposals for fitting a pad to the lower part of the axle centre box, to receive the tie rod.

Mr. Royce does not mind which one is chosen and would like you to do the one that is easiest.

We should like to know what method was adopted in the case of the old 40/50 back axles with the aluminium centre box and a tie rod.
